Enhanced methane recovery and exoelectrogen-methanogen evolution from low-strength wastewater in an up-flow biofilm reactor with conductive granular graphite fillers
Next Previous
Abstract
Methane yield increased 22 times from low-strength wastewater by applying conductive fillers. Conductive fillers accelerated the start-up stage of anaerobic biofilm reactor. Conductive fillers altered methanogens structure.
